The Complete Guide 2024 Incl Nextjs Redux Free Download New |verified| -
// actions.js export const fetchData = () => return async (dispatch) => dispatch( type: 'FETCH_DATA_REQUEST' ); try const response = await fetch('https://jsonplaceholder.typicode.com/posts'); const data = await response.json(); dispatch( type: 'FETCH_DATA_SUCCESS', payload: data ); catch (error) dispatch( type: 'FETCH_DATA_FAILURE', payload: error );
In this example, we're using the useSelector hook to select the data , loading , and error state from the Redux store. We're also using the useDispatch hook to dispatch the fetchData action.
const initialState = {};
npx create-next-next-app@latest nextjs-redux-guide cd nextjs-redux-guide Use code with caution.
Excellent SEO and fast initial page loads (Next.js). the complete guide 2024 incl nextjs redux free download new
const selectCounter = (state) => state.counter; const selectDoubleValue = createSelector( [selectCounter], (counter) => counter.value * 2 );
Look for "Next.js 14 Redux Toolkit Tutorial 2024" on YouTube channels like JavaScript Mastery or Codevolution. Free Boilerplate/Starter Kit (Download): // actions
Pass server-fetched data downstream to the client store smoothly without causing HTML mismatch errors (hydration errors). Step-by-Step Implementation 1. Project Initialization & Dependencies
